Awesome! I just bought a Discovery and now Im beginning to eye the marauder. Id really recommend the 6.5 inch TKO brake. I found everyone's claims about how quiet they were  hard to believe at first. After installing one its amazing how quiet it is. No one will know you're shooting until they hear the "thwack!" on your target. Seriously, its worth every cent.
